Emilio Moro from Ribera de Duero in the heart of the DO is seen by the other top producers as one of the emerging new stars in the area. With 70 hectares of Tinto Fino from old autochthonous clones, Emilio Moro makes wines that excel in purity, elegance and complexity.

While you wait for the 'great' wines of Moro to reach their peak, you can already fully enjoy this fruity, youthful Tempranillo from Emilio Moro. The Finca Resalso comes from the (relatively) younger vines. In the glass, the wine has a cherry red color with purple hues. In the nose, the aroma and intensity of the wine stimulates the senses. Pure fruit enjoyment of strawberries, cherries, raspberries, licorice and black forest fruits. The Finca Resalso is lively, with a spicy touch and just enough structure due to the 4 months aging in French barriques. It is a very fine wine with a well-developed structure that makes it very pleasant to drink. The Resalso has an excellent price-quality ratio. This is a great wine with steaks, hamburgers, stews and the better charcuterie. Wine is like a living being that you have to understand and take care of' is a quote by Emilio Moro after which a large winery within Ribera del Duero was named. The contemporary cellar, which replaced the old one in 2001, is located in the hamlet of Pesquera de Duero, 198 kilometers north of Madrid. Emilio's grandsons, Javier and José, are in charge and pursue a consistent quality policy. The grapes, all tinto fino (a regional variant of tempranillo) come from more than 200 hectares at an altitude of 750 to 1000 meters. The youngest wine, which received four months of barrel rest, is called Finca Resalso. Of which the delicious 2014 seduces with thick black fruit, including that of cassis, hints of licorice and laurel, a pinch of spice and a very controlled amount of wood.
